antipônimos
Antiponyms are words that have opposite meanings. This concept is also known as antonyms. For example, hot and cold are antiponyms. Similarly, up and down, big and small, and fast and slow are common examples of antiponyms. The relationship between antiponyms is one of contrast. They represent opposing ends of a spectrum or a binary choice.
